The 340 really is the sweet spot for the micros I do believe. I don't think you could go wrong. My axe340 will be with me for a while I think.
That's why a 340 TD came home with me and sees the most tree stand time. I too believe 340 is the sweet spot for Micros. Though Boo has a point about the limbs on the 400 TD. They're the top of the food chain in my opinion. I'd love to see them on a Micro in the 340-350fps range. You can't go too much beyond that without starting to bring cranks into the conversation. And I prefer the crank to be an option, not a requirement. Put the 400 limbs on a 340-350fps range bow and you'd have a seriously rugged Micro platform. Given the limb thickness, you should be able to shave some draw length off of the package. I don't think you'd have something 308 Short length shooting 340fps, but it may come closer than you think. Hmm, a 340 Short anyone?

I built my dad a 340 Short...

Original Gen 2 (3?) riser from my 308 Short Banshee.
Camo limbs purchased off fb group.
Rail from Matrix 330 cut down to give same power stroke as a 340 micro.
Matrix Sapphire stock to give same LOP as a 308 Short.

Hence, 340 Short

I also picked up another Sapphire stock, my brother might take that to turn his Micro 355 into a 355 Short.
